Y2Si3N4O3 Crystal Structure
General Information
- Phase Label(s): Y2Si3N4O3
- Structure Class(es): –
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: tP24
- Space Group: 113
- Phase Prototype: Y2Si3(N0.8O0.2)5O2
- Measurement Detail(s): automatic diffractometer (determination of cell parameters), automatic diffractometer; Philips PW1700 (determination of structural parameters), X-rays, Co Kα (determination of cell and structural parameters)
- Phase Class(es): –
- Compound Class(es): silicate
- Interpretation Detail(s): complete structure determined, Rietveld refinement; 26 variables, RP = 0.087; wRP = 0.116
- Sample Detail(s): sample prepared from Si3N4, Y2O3, SiO2, powder (determination of cell and structural parameters)
Substance Summary
- Standard Formula: Y2Si3N4O3
- Alphabetic Formula: N4O3Si3Y2
- Published Formula: Y2Si3N4O3
- Refined Formula: N4O3Si3Y2
- Wyckoff Sequence: 113,fe3ca
- Z Formula Units: 2
- Density: ρ = 4.28 Mg·m−3
